Output 58a93e133cd53d291730063ccb97122014a110f1fbc2a251370cabb481e10f07:12

value
71668
script pubkey
OP_0 OP_PUSHBYTES_20 55efdcfa438bccd712c19d9181371ba94e0f5cb0
address
bc1q2hhae7jr30xdwykpnkgczdcm498q7h9s382f5c
transaction
58a93e133cd53d291730063ccb97122014a110f1fbc2a251370cabb481e10f07